Overview
Released in 2001 by the Japanese developer Psikyo, this arcade-style shooter game is a classic example of a vertical shooting game known for its intense action and innovative gameplay. Set in a futuristic world where players control helicopters to battle against numerous enemies, the game is an essential title for fans of the shoot ’em up genre.
Gameplay Mechanics
The game is distinguished by its unique mechanic that allows players to freely rotate their helicopters 360 degrees, providing a dynamic and strategic approach to combat. Players must navigate through various stages filled with enemy drones, ships, and powerful bosses, utilizing an array of weapon upgrades and tactical maneuvers to survive.

Legacy
Though it might not have reached mainstream success, the game has garnered a cult following among enthusiasts of arcade shooters. Its challenging gameplay and distinctive rotation mechanics have made it a memorable entry in Psikyo’s lineup of titles.
